We checked out a few websites to use in order to improve our presentations. The websites are below;

Nearpod: An interactive presentation website that has VR (360° Map), voting, pie chart, true/false activity, drawing, and collaborative board features.

Mentimeter: Another interactive website with many features like interactive polls, quizzes, Q&A, and word cloud.

Hypersay: Again, an interactive website 😀. The site has a chatbox, question tab, and clapping feature.

Slido: A presentation website that has features like polling, Q&A, multiple choice quiz, rating, ranking, etc.

Canva: A website that has informative graphic templates about many topics.

Postermywall: Another website with many templates that can be used in order to improve presentations visually.

Piktochart: Yes, again a website with informative templates. 👍

Pixabay & Pexel: Websites that have free-to-use pictures. Presenters can use pictures from these sites to avoid any kind of copyright issues.


In some part of the lesson, our teachers mentioned how it's not safe to post our pictures on the internet, and as teacher candidates, we should be very careful with what we post. Melike teacher said that we should not share pictures without the parents' consent and Gökhan teacher said that we should hide the face and the hair of the students.
